Overview
Mpower Direct is an energy supplier specializing in 100% renewable energy. Since our founding in 2009, our mission has been to offer sustainable, affordable, and reliable renewable energy options to customers seeking to reduce their carbon footprint. We service residential and commercial customers across 10 States and we are growing daily! Our success hinges on a solid team, and we invest heavily in developing our in-house staff.
We proudly offer an exciting opportunity for a full-time Regional Sales Manager based in our Chicago office. We're searching for a dynamic and experienced Regional Sales Manager to join our growing team and take charge of overseeing the Region across 3 of our thriving sales offices in Chicago, Cincinnati and Pittsburgh. This role differs from your average Regional Sales role as you'll be at the forefront of a rapidly growing industry, helping homeowners switch to clean, renewable energy.
This role requires someone with a strategic mind, a relentless work ethic, a constant desire for growth, and the ability to build and support high-performing sales teams.
